The regulations concerning the commercialisation of herbal teas and other CBD products

The sale of CBD in France, in herbal tea form and otherwise, has seen many twists and turns over the years. In France, the government had ruled in December 2021 on the production and commercialisation of CBD products. Producers and consumers were eagerly awaiting this essential clarification of the legislation and had been disappointed by the decision taken. Today, certain varieties of CBD products are permitted. However, a long road still lies ahead for the future of cannabidiol in France.

The change in law on CBD products

The ministerial decree of December 2021 prohibited the sale and consumption, in France, of hemp flowers and leaves containing CBD. Even though CBD, a molecule derived from cannabis, has no psychotropic effects, the French government considered it difficult to determine which flowers or leaves contained CBD or THC. The impact on CBD product businesses, such as herbal teas, was considerable.

The commercialisation of CBD-derived products

The CBD-derived products authorised for sale and consumption without restriction include, among others, cannabidiol resins and oils. The ban enacted in December 2021 primarily concerned CBD products intended for smoking.

Did you know that certain criteria must also be respected when distributing CBD products on the market? The original cannabis plant must have a THC level below 0.3%. The producer, seller or online shop may not promote the therapeutic benefits of CBD. In France, this molecule is indeed still under review. It is also essential to ensure a clear distinction between cannabis and CBD. Failing to do so would constitute an incitement to drug use.

The consumption of hemp flowers and leaves in France

Herbal teas, for their part, were banned in France as a result of this decree. These drinks could indeed be obtained from infusions of hemp flowers or raw leaves. According to the authorities, distinguishing between plants containing CBD or THC, a psychotropic substance, was far from straightforward. The raw hemp contained in flowers intended for herbal teas represents a large part of CBD product sales in France. This decision therefore had a significant impact in the CBD sphere.

The future of the consumption and sale of CBD leaves and flowers

Did you know that the Conseil d'État had lifted the ban on the sale of CBD flowers and leaves? Making yourself a herbal tea is now legal. The ban on all these varieties of CBD products will therefore have been short-lived. Certain restrictions remain in place.

  1. However, the THC level of the plant concerned must not exceed 0.3%.
  2. The sale of CBD flowers and leaves remains prohibited to minors.


Do not lose sight of the fact that this suspension of the French government's decision still needs to be examined by the relevant authorities.

European Union regulations on the use of CBD products

The legalisation of cannabidiol, and of CBD herbal teas, in France has been a real uphill battle. According to the Court of Justice of the European Union, CBD is not a narcotic. No psychotropic or harmful effects on the health of consumers can be attributed to it.

The history of CBD legalisation in France

During the "Kanavape" case, the French State took legal action against a company offering CBD oils. The European Court ruled in favour of the sellers. Reiterating in the process that:

  • CBD is permitted, provided the THC level does not exceed 0.2%;
  • the sale of these products benefits from the principle of free competition within the European Union.

Despite this, France subsequently filed a bill in June 2021 aimed at, among other things, banning the sale of CBD flowers.

The tug of war between the European Court and French justice

In October 2021, the European Court announced its full decision on France's draft decree. The authorisation of the trade in cannabidiol flowers was reaffirmed. The French justice system, for its part, submitted a new decree at the end of 2021 permitting the cultivation of flowers and leaves for CBD extraction only. This effectively signalled the end of cannabidiol herbal teas. It was then that the suspension of the decree was decided by the interim relief judge a few weeks later. The sale and consumption of cannabidiol, in the form of flowers and leaves, and therefore as herbal tea, are currently enjoying a brief respite.
